Idaho Prize for Poetry A project of Lost Horse Press (see other related projects). About The Idaho Prize is a national competition offering a cash prize plus publication by Lost Horse Press for a book-length poetry manuscript. Fees Notice: This project charges fees (or requires purchases) for all submissions. The fee is USD $28 (above average for contests).
